A Postgraduate Certificate in Irish Language Evaluation equips students with advanced skills in assessing the proficiency and fluency of Irish speakers. This specialized program focuses on developing practical expertise in language testing and assessment methodologies, crucial for careers in education, translation, and linguistic analysis.
Learning outcomes for this Postgraduate Certificate include mastering various evaluation techniques, including oral and written assessments. Students gain proficiency in designing and implementing robust language tests, analyzing assessment data, and reporting findings effectively. The program also cultivates critical thinking and research skills applicable to diverse linguistic contexts.
The duration of a Postgraduate Certificate in Irish Language Evaluation typically spans one academic year, often delivered through a combination of online and in-person learning modules. The program's flexible structure caters to the needs of working professionals seeking to enhance their skills in Irish language assessment.
